My career in event production began in college, where I became known for organizing fun and memorable gatherings. That passion evolved into a professional journey, starting at a modeling and talent agency where I got my first taste of large-scale event planning.
After graduating from Arizona State University, I launched my career in strategic fundraising and event management with Patricia Hurley & Associates in Chicago. As a Lead Account Executive, I managed events with financial outcomes ranging from $250,000 to over $7,000,000.
​
Moving to New York, I led the events department at boutique fundraising consulting firm Perry Davis Associates. There, I honed my expertise in high-end nonprofit fundraising events, working within tight budgets to create meaningful, large-scale experiences. My passion for immersive event production led me to pivot into freelance experiential event planning—and I haven’t looked back.
​
I now specialize in dynamic conference planning, company and group retreats, and large-scale immersive events. From strategy to execution, I create seamless and engaging experiences that leave a lasting impact.
